ARC’TERYX conveys the allure of the mountains through its products, such as the opening of a limited-time experience center on Mount Takao where visitors can try out gear. As the number of stores continues to grow, a new brand store has opened in Tokyo’s Kanda district, home to numerous outdoor shops.
A space filled with natural light and a sense of openness. It features a wide selection of high-performance products, including apparel, shoes, backpacks, and accessories.
“Sleeping Lion” Film Screening & Talk Event
On Sunday, July 5, there will be a screening of the documentary “SLEEPING LION,” which follows world-renowned professional rock climber Sachi Anma, followed by a talk event. With photographer Takemi Suzuki—who has worked on numerous climbing films and photo projects—serving as the interviewer, the event will delve deeper into Sachi Anma’s challenges.
